Yeildings: 6servings
Direction and Ingredients
Amount Ingredient Preparation
3 pounds pork spareribs cut into serving size pieces
1 cup maple syrup
3 tablespoons orange juice, concentrated
3 tablespoons ketchup
2 tablespoons soy sauce
1 tablespoon dijon mustard
1 tablespoon worcestershire sauce
1 teaspoon curry powder
1 cloves garlic peeled and minced
2 Green onions minced
1 tablespoon sesame seeds roasted
 Place the ribs, meaty side up, on a rack in a greased 13"x9"x2" 
baking pan.

Cover pan tightly with foil. Bake at 35 for 1 hour and 15
minutes.

Meanwhile, combine the next nine ingredients in a saucepan.

Bring to a boil over medium heat.

Reduce heat; simmer for 15 minutes, stirring occasionally.

Drain ribs; remove rack and return ribs to pan.

Cover with sauce.

Bake, uncovered, for 35 minutes, basting occasionally.

Sprinkle with sesame seeds just before serving.
